WebNational Center for Biotechnology Information WebMay 31, 2024 · Friction is the resistance to the movement of one surface across another. High friction levels means more sticky, and low friction levels mean slippery. As a result, high friction levels cause higher shear distortions within the skin which is what leads to blisters. Low friction levels prevent high shear distortions and therefore prevents blisters. WebApr 19, 2024 · Friction. Friction occurs when the skin rubs against clothing or bedding. WebFeb 25, 2024 · Introduction. Shear friction action is a primary load transfer mechanism at concrete-to-concrete interfaces found in the connections between columns and corbels, between squat shear walls and foundations, of dapped-end beams, and shear keys (ACI-ASCE Committee 426 1973).
